Date: 2019/10/21 | File Size: 15.21 MB |
Duration: 00:00:11 | Frame Size: 1920 x 1080 |
Hospital staff are seen holing up placards while protesting in a hospital in Hong Kong on October 21, 2019,
|
€ 399.00 |
|
€ 50.00 |